Featured picture for "Chattanooga Gas Prices Up Nearly 10 Cents A Gallon Over The Past Week"

Chattanooga Gas Prices Up Nearly 10 Cents A Gallon Over The Past Week

Average gasoline prices in Chattanooga have risen 9.7 cents per gallon in the last week, averaging $2.78/g today, according to GasBuddy's survey of 170 stations in Chattanooga.
